MGT334 - Data-Driven Decision Making

3 credit hour(s)
This course examines the dynamic nature of management information systems (MIS) from the perspective of the users to add effectiveness and efficiency to decision making as well as routine operations. Students learn how to use data analytics to ascertain useful information managers need, to make sound decisions using diverse techniques. Students explore decision tools, such as basic descriptive data and common assessment practices, to inform and improve the management decision process within organizations.
